Grand Forks, ND — The 2022-23 farm meeting season kicks off this Wednesday and Thursday with the annual Prairie Grains Conference at the Alerus Center in Grand Forks. The Prairie Grains Conference is hosted by the Minnesota Association of Wheat Growers, North Dakota Grains Growers Association, and Minnesota Barley and features research sessions, grower meetings, keynote speakers, an ag expo, and more.

The opening day of the Prairie Grains Conference features the annual meetings from the various grower groups, plus a number of breakout and research sessions, according to Minnesota Wheat Growers CEO Charlie Vogel.

A trio of keynote speakers will highlight Thursday of the Prairie Grains Conference covering topics such as marketing, weather, and future trends. Vogel says they are proud to welcome Paul Gerdes of CHS, Mark Jirik of the Northern Crops Institute, and NDAWN’s Daryl Ritchison.

Vogel is also very excited about this year’s Ag Expo. In between sessions and keynotes, he encourages growers to check out the latest in agriculture.
